Why do these standard chairs fail? Well, for starters, most conventional office chairs are designed with a weight capacity of around 250 pounds. If you weigh more than that, or even close to it, you’re putting undue stress on the chair’s components – from the gas lift and casters to the frame and upholstery. This isn’t just about discomfort; it’s about durability. Over time, these chairs wear out faster, sag, and break down, leading to poor posture, increased back pain, and even circulation issues. In fact, an inadequate chair can contribute significantly to the fact that nearly 80% of adults experience back pain at some point in their lives.

Beyond Weight Capacity: The True Meaning of Heavy-Duty Design

When you’re looking at office chairs, especially for bigger or taller individuals, the first thing you probably check is that weight capacity number. It’s like the main headline, right? “Supports up to 400 lbs!” But here’s the secret: that number is just the tip of the iceberg. A truly “heavy-duty” chair isn’t just about having a higher weight limit; it’s about the entire engineering philosophy behind it. It’s built from the ground up to handle more stress, more movement, and more sustained use than your average office chair.

Think about it this way: a regular chair might technically support a heavier person for a short period, but will it stand up to daily use, the shifting of weight, and the inevitable wear and tear over months or even years? Probably not. A genuinely heavy-duty chair features reinforced steel frames, industrial-grade components, and higher-density foams that don’t compress and flatten out after a few weeks. This means the gas lift won’t slowly sink, the casters won’t crumble, and the back won’t start wobbling like a loose tooth.

It’s about the details you might not even see. For example, the type of bolts used, the thickness of the steel in the base, or the quality of the welds. Manufacturers of these specialized chairs often put them through rigorous testing that goes far beyond standard BIFMA (Business and Institutional Furniture Manufacturers Association) requirements. They’re mimicking years of aggressive use, ensuring that every component can withstand the stresses placed upon it by a larger individual, day in and day out.

So, when you’re making your choice, look past just the weight number. Ask about the materials, the frame construction, and if possible, any specific durability tests the chair has undergone. One of the easiest things you can do is regular cleaning. Dust and crumbs can accumulate in crevices and on fabric, making your chair look old before its time. Depending on the material – be it fabric, mesh, or leather – a simple vacuum, a damp cloth, or a specialized cleaner can work wonders. For heavier use, consider protecting high-wear areas. For instance, if you often lean on the armrests, make sure the padding is secure, and clean them regularly, as they can collect oils from skin and become discolored.

Beyond just cleaning, pay attention to the moving parts. The casters, or wheels, are crucial, especially on heavier chairs. If they start squeaking or sticking, check for hair, dust, or debris caught in them. A quick clean and maybe a tiny bit of silicone spray can get them rolling smoothly again. Also, occasionally check the bolts and screws that hold the chair together. Over time, with constant movement and shifting weight, they can sometimes loosen. A quick tightening every few months can prevent wobbles and ensure the chair remains stable and secure.

1. Don’t Just Look at the Weight Limit, Understand It

When you’re on the hunt for a chair, the first thing your eyes probably dart to is the weight capacity. And you’re right to do so! But here’s a friendly tip: don’t just meet the limit; exceed it if you can. If a chair says it supports 300 lbs, and you weigh 290 lbs, you’re constantly pushing its limits. This means faster wear and tear, and components like the gas lift or the base might struggle, leading to an uncomfortable or even unsafe experience down the line. Aim for a chair with a capacity significantly higher than your actual weight – say, 350 lbs or even 400 lbs if you weigh 250-300 lbs. This buffer isn’t just about safety; it’s about longevity and consistent performance.

Think of it like buying a truck to haul heavy loads; you wouldn’t get one just barely capable of carrying your maximum weight, would you? You’d get one with a bit of extra oomph to ensure it performs reliably and lasts longer. The same goes for your office chair. A higher weight capacity usually means reinforced components like a heavy-duty steel frame, a Class 4 gas lift (which is the strongest kind), and robust casters. These are the unsung heroes that prevent sagging, wobbling, and unexpected breakdowns, making your investment truly worthwhile for years to come.

5. Size Does Matter: Get the Right Fit

This might seem obvious, but it’s often overlooked. Many chairs might boast a high weight capacity but still have a seat pan that’s too narrow or too shallow. For us, a wider and deeper seat is crucial. You want to be able to sit comfortably without your thighs touching the armrests or feeling like your legs are hanging off the edge without support. Aim for a seat width of at least 20-22 inches, and ensure the seat depth can accommodate your upper legs fully while still allowing a few inches between the edge of the seat and the back of your knees.

Similarly, consider the backrest height and width. You want a backrest that supports your entire back, from your lower lumbar region all the way up to your shoulders. If your shoulders are spilling over the sides or the top of the backrest, it’s not providing adequate support, which can lead to slouching and discomfort. 6. Don’t Underestimate the Base and Wheels

When you’re a heavier individual, the base and casters (that’s what the wheels are called!) of your office chair are absolutely critical components. A flimsy plastic base that’s standard on many chairs is simply not going to cut it for long. You need a wide, robust, five-star base, ideally made from heavy-duty steel or polished aluminum. This broader, stronger base provides superior stability and prevents the chair from tipping, even when you lean back or shift your weight. It’s the foundation of your chair, and it needs to be unshakeable.

And those wheels? They’re more important than you might think! Standard plastic casters can crack under significant weight and often struggle to roll smoothly, especially on carpet. Look for larger, more durable casters, often made from polyurethane (PU) or rubberized materials. These not only glide effortlessly across different floor types (protecting your hard floors from scratches, by the way!) but are also built to withstand much more stress. A good set of casters means you can move around your workspace with ease, reducing strain on your body and allowing for fluid, comfortable motion throughout your day.

7. The Peace of Mind Factor: Warranty and Reputation

Finally, after you’ve considered all the physical attributes of the chair, don’t forget about the company standing behind it. A robust warranty is a strong indicator of a manufacturer’s confidence in their product’s durability. For a chair designed for heavy users, look for a warranty that covers the frame and major components (like the gas lift and mechanism) for at least 5 to 10 years. This isn’t just a piece of paper; it’s your insurance policy, ensuring that your investment is protected against manufacturing defects or premature component failure.

What makes an office chair “heavy duty” or “big & tall”?

These terms aren’t just about making a chair bigger; they signify a fundamental difference in construction designed to accommodate higher weight capacities and larger body frames safely and comfortably. Think of it like a truck versus a car – while both get you around, a truck is built with a stronger chassis, suspension, and engine to handle heavier loads. Similarly, heavy-duty chairs feature reinforced components, often using commercial-grade materials that can withstand more stress over time.

Specifically, you’ll typically find an extra-strong steel or heavy-gauge aluminum frame, higher-density foam in the seat and back that won’t flatten out quickly, and more robust upholstery fabrics designed for greater wear and tear. Even the small details matter, like heavy-duty casters (wheels) and a more powerful gas lift cylinder, all engineered to ensure stability, durability, and a smooth experience, putting your mind at ease about the chair’s ability to support you day in and day out.

How much should I expect to spend on a good quality office chair for heavy individuals?

You should generally expect to view a quality heavy-duty office chair as a significant investment, much like a good mattress or a reliable vehicle. The price range can vary quite a bit, typically starting from around $300-$400 for entry-level models with basic heavy-duty features, and easily going up to $800 or even over $1000 for chairs from premium brands that offer advanced ergonomics, high-end materials, and extended warranties. The higher cost reflects the superior materials, engineering, and testing required to ensure these chairs can safely and comfortably support heavier loads over many years.
